If you want to get into it it wouldn't be too taxing to start from the beginning of the reboot - Eccleston only did 1 season, David Tennant did 3 I think and we're just at the beginning of the second season with Matt Smith.

You could start at the beginning of last season and it would be okay - but really if you want to get into it you would be best to start at the beginning of the reboot. There are only 13 episodes in each season too.
